Using an electric knife sharpener is a convenient and efficient way to maintain the sharpness of your kitchen knives, ensuring they perform optimally for slicing, dicing, and chopping. These devices are designed to simplify the sharpening process, making it accessible even for those without professional skills. To use an electric knife sharpener, start by selecting the appropriate slot for your knife’s condition—typically coarse for dull blades, fine for regular maintenance, and honing for polishing. Insert the knife blade at the correct angle, usually guided by the sharpener’s design, and gently draw it through the slot in a smooth, controlled motion. Repeat this process a few times on each side of the blade, following the manufacturer’s instructions, to achieve a sharp edge. Always prioritize safety by handling the knife carefully and unplugging the sharpener when not in use. With proper technique, an electric knife sharpener can extend the life of your knives and enhance your cooking experience.

Understanding Sharpener Types: Identify manual, electric, or belt sharpeners for specific knife needs

Electric knife sharpeners offer speed and convenience, but they’re not a one-size-fits-all solution. Understanding the differences between manual, electric, and belt sharpeners is crucial for matching the tool to your knife’s needs. Manual sharpeners, often compact and affordable, rely on user skill and consistency. They’re ideal for light maintenance on kitchen knives but may struggle with heavily damaged edges. Electric sharpeners, on the other hand, automate the process with guided slots, making them user-friendly for beginners. However, their aggressive abrasives can remove more metal than necessary, shortening a knife’s lifespan if overused. Belt sharpeners, typically found in professional settings, offer precision and control but require experience to avoid mistakes. Each type has its place—choose based on your knife’s condition, your skill level, and how much material you’re willing to sacrifice for sharpness.

Consider the knife’s purpose when selecting a sharpener. For everyday kitchen knives, an electric sharpener’s guided system ensures a consistent angle, restoring sharpness quickly. However, for high-end chef’s knives or Japanese blades with harder steel, a manual sharpener or whetstone is gentler, preserving the blade’s integrity. Belt sharpeners excel for outdoor or survival knives with thicker, tougher edges, as they can handle heavier grinding. A key takeaway: electric sharpeners are efficient but less forgiving, while manual and belt options demand more effort but offer greater control. Always assess the knife’s material and intended use before deciding.

To illustrate, imagine a serrated bread knife versus a straight-edge chef’s knife. An electric sharpener’s slots may not accommodate the serrations, making a manual rod or specialized tool more suitable. Conversely, a dull cleaver benefits from an electric sharpener’s power, quickly restoring its edge for heavy-duty tasks. The takeaway? Pair the sharpener to the knife’s design and function, not just its dullness.

Finally, maintenance matters. Electric sharpeners require periodic cleaning to remove metal filings that can clog the mechanism. Manual sharpeners, especially ceramic rods, need minimal upkeep but may wear out over time. Belt sharpeners demand regular belt replacement and careful tension adjustment. Regardless of type, consistency is key—regular light sharpening extends a knife’s life more effectively than infrequent, aggressive sessions. Choose the right tool, use it wisely, and your knives will stay sharp for years to come.

Preparing the Knife: Clean and inspect the knife for damage before sharpening

Before you even think about sharpening, consider the knife's condition. A dirty blade can clog the sharpener's mechanism, while unseen damage might worsen under pressure. Start by washing the knife with warm, soapy water and a soft sponge, avoiding abrasive scrubbers that could scratch the surface. Rinse thoroughly and dry completely with a clean towel to prevent rust. This simple step ensures the sharpener works efficiently and prolongs the life of both the tool and the knife.

Inspection is just as critical as cleaning. Hold the knife under bright light and examine the edge for chips, dents, or uneven wear. Run your fingernail gently along the blade—if it catches, the edge is damaged. Minor imperfections can often be corrected during sharpening, but severe damage may require professional attention. Ignoring these issues can lead to unsatisfactory results or even harm the sharpener. Think of this step as a diagnostic check before proceeding with the "treatment."

For those new to knife care, here’s a practical tip: use a magnifying glass to spot microscopic flaws. Even a small burr or nick can affect the sharpening process. If you’re unsure about the knife’s condition, compare it to a known sharp blade. This side-by-side analysis can highlight problems you might otherwise miss. Remember, a well-prepared knife is the foundation of a successful sharpening session.

Finally, consider the knife’s material. Stainless steel and carbon steel blades require different handling, and some electric sharpeners are not suitable for certain materials. Check the manufacturer’s guidelines for compatibility. For instance, serrated or ceramic knives often need specialized tools and techniques. By cleaning and inspecting thoroughly, you’re not just preparing the knife—you’re setting the stage for precision and safety in the sharpening process.

Setting the Angle: Adjust the sharpener to match the knife’s bevel angle

The bevel angle is the most critical factor in achieving a sharp edge, and it varies widely across knife types. A chef’s knife typically has a 20-degree angle per side, while a Japanese santoku may require 15 degrees. Electric sharpeners often come with adjustable guides, but understanding your knife’s geometry is essential. If the angle is too steep, the edge will be durable but less sharp; too shallow, and it may chip easily. Always consult the knife’s manufacturer or examine its existing bevel to determine the correct angle before sharpening.

Adjusting the sharpener’s angle guide is straightforward but requires precision. Most electric sharpeners have preset angles (e.g., 15, 20, or 25 degrees) or a manual adjustment mechanism. For preset models, select the guide that matches your knife’s bevel angle. If using a manual adjustment, align the guide with the knife’s edge, ensuring the blade sits flush against the sharpening surface. Test the alignment by gently drawing the knife through the sharpener without power to confirm it glides smoothly without wobbling.

A common mistake is ignoring the knife’s existing bevel, especially with older or heavily used blades. If the original angle is unclear, start with a slightly higher angle (e.g., 20 degrees) and refine as needed. Over time, repeated sharpening can alter the bevel, so periodically reassess the angle to maintain consistency. For serrated knives, avoid using the angle guide altogether; instead, use the sharpener’s dedicated serrated slot or a manual method to preserve the teeth.

The consequences of an incorrect angle are immediate and noticeable. Too steep an angle will create a blunt edge, while too shallow an angle may result in a fragile, chipping-prone blade. For example, sharpening a 15-degree Japanese knife at 20 degrees will round the edge, reducing its slicing efficiency. Conversely, sharpening a 20-degree Western knife at 15 degrees will weaken the edge under heavy use. Always prioritize precision over speed, as a correctly set angle ensures both sharpness and longevity.

To ensure accuracy, practice on an inexpensive knife before sharpening your prized blades. Mark the bevel angle on a piece of paper or use a protractor for visual reference. Some sharpeners include angle finders or calibration tools, which can be invaluable for beginners. Remember, the goal is not just to sharpen but to maintain the knife’s original design and functionality. With patience and attention to detail, setting the correct angle becomes second nature, elevating your sharpening results from adequate to exceptional.

Sharpening Technique: Use smooth, consistent strokes to avoid overheating or damaging the blade

Smooth, consistent strokes are the backbone of effective electric knife sharpening. Unlike manual sharpening, where pressure and angle are entirely in your hands, electric sharpeners automate much of the process. However, the rhythm and control you apply still matter. Jerky or uneven strokes can cause the blade to heat excessively, altering its temper and dulling its edge prematurely. Think of it as sanding wood—a steady hand ensures an even finish, while erratic movements leave scratches and imperfections.

To master this technique, start by positioning the knife at the correct angle, typically guided by the sharpener’s slot design. Apply gentle, uniform pressure as you draw the blade through the sharpener. Aim for a stroke speed of about 1–2 seconds per pass, allowing the abrasive wheels to work without friction buildup. For most standard kitchen knives, 3–5 strokes per side are sufficient to restore sharpness. Overdoing it risks thinning the blade unnecessarily.

A common mistake is pressing too hard, assuming more force equals better results. This is a myth. Electric sharpeners are designed to work with minimal pressure, relying on their motorized abrasives to do the heavy lifting. If you hear grinding or see sparks, ease up—these are signs of overheating. Instead, focus on maintaining a steady pace, as if you’re tracing a line with a pen. This consistency ensures the entire edge is sharpened evenly, from heel to tip.

For serrated or specialty blades, adapt your technique. Use shorter, targeted strokes on serrated edges, focusing on the flat side of each tooth. Avoid dragging the blade through the sharpener at an angle, as this can damage the serrations. Similarly, thinner blades, like those on fillet knives, require lighter pressure and fewer passes to prevent thinning. Always refer to the manufacturer’s guidelines for blade-specific recommendations.

In conclusion, smooth, consistent strokes are not just a suggestion—they’re a necessity for preserving your knife’s integrity. By controlling your movements and respecting the sharpener’s design, you’ll achieve a razor-sharp edge without compromising the blade’s longevity. Practice makes perfect, so take your time and let the machine do its job while you focus on precision.

Finishing and Testing: Hone the edge and test sharpness on paper or tomatoes

The final stage of using an electric knife sharpener is where the magic happens—honing and testing the edge to reveal a razor-sharp blade. This step is crucial, as it transforms a merely sharpened knife into a precision cutting tool. The process is simple yet satisfying, ensuring your knife is not just sharp but also refined and ready for any task.

The Art of Honing: After the initial sharpening, the knife's edge may still have microscopic burrs or imperfections. This is where honing comes into play. Most electric sharpeners have a honing stage, often the final slot or wheel, designed to remove these burrs and create a smooth, keen edge. The technique is straightforward: gently draw the knife through the honing slot, typically 3 to 5 times on each side, maintaining a consistent angle. This step refines the edge, enhancing its sharpness and durability.

Testing Sharpness: Paper or Tomato? Now, the moment of truth—testing the knife's sharpness. Two common methods are the paper test and the tomato test, each offering a unique perspective on the knife's performance. The paper test involves cutting a piece of standard printer paper. A sharp knife will slice through effortlessly, leaving a clean cut without tearing or catching. This test is ideal for precision-focused tasks like slicing meats or chopping herbs. For a more practical, kitchen-centric approach, the tomato test is a favorite. A sharp knife will glide through a ripe tomato without crushing or squashing it, demonstrating its ability to handle delicate cutting tasks.

Practical Tips for Optimal Results: For the best outcomes, ensure the knife is clean and dry before honing. Any debris or moisture can affect the honing process. When testing, use a fresh piece of paper or a firm, ripe tomato for accurate results. If the knife struggles with either test, consider repeating the sharpening and honing process, focusing on maintaining a consistent angle. Remember, the goal is not just sharpness but also edge retention, ensuring your knife stays sharper for longer.

In the world of knife sharpening, the finishing and testing phase is a blend of art and science. It requires attention to detail and a keen eye for perfection. By mastering this step, you'll not only achieve a sharp knife but also understand the nuances of edge refinement, making your electric sharpener an invaluable tool in your kitchen or workshop. This process empowers you to maintain your knives at their peak performance, ensuring every cut is a pleasure.
